INSPECTION
PROCEDURE
1. INSPECT WINDSHIELD WIPER MOTOR ASSEMBLY
(a) Check the LO operation.
Text in Illustration
*a |
Component without harness connected (Windshield Wiper Motor Assembly) |
(1) Apply battery voltage to the windshield wiper motor connector and check the speed of the windshield wiper motor assembly.
OK:
Measurement Condition |
Specified Condition |
---|---|
Battery positive (+) → Terminal 1 (+1) Battery negative (-) → Terminal 5 (E) |
Motor operates at low speed |
If the result is not as specified, replace the windshield wiper motor assembly.
(b) Check the HI operation.
(1) Apply battery voltage to the windshield wiper motor connector and check the speed of the windshield wiper motor assembly.
OK:
Measurement Condition |
Specified Condition |
---|---|
Battery positive (+) → Terminal 4 (+2) Battery negative (-) → Terminal 5 (E) |
Motor operates at high speed |
If the result is not as specified, replace the windshield wiper motor assembly.
